I cloned this repo and tried to build locally (to try to debug/fix an issue I reported).

The `npm i` command failed in `tsc`

```text
$ npm i

> ajv-cli@5.0.0 prepublish
> npm run build

> ajv-cli@5.0.0 build
> rimraf dist && tsc

src/commands/ajv.ts:89:11 - error TS18046: 'err' is of type 'unknown'.

89 if (err.code === "MODULE_NOT_FOUND") {
~~~

src/commands/ajv.ts:91:110 - error TS18046: 'err' is of type 'unknown'.

91 `'ts-node' is required for the TypeScript configuration files. Make sure it is installed\nError: ${err.message}`
~~~

src/commands/util.ts:55:25 - error TS18046: 'err' is of type 'unknown'.

55 const msg: string = err.message
~~~

src/commands/util.ts:85:29 - error TS18046: 'err' is of type 'unknown'.

85 console.error(`error: ${err.message}`)
~~~

Found 4 errors in 2 files.

Errors Files
2 src/commands/ajv.ts:89
2 src/commands/util.ts:55
npm ERR! code 2
npm ERR! path ~/dev/tools/ajv-cli
npm ERR! command failed
npm ERR! command sh -c npm run build
```

Opening the project in VSCode, I also see (other) errors such as

```
Cannot find module 'json5'. Did you mean to set the 'moduleResolution' option to 'nodenext', or to add aliases to the 'paths' option? ts(2792)
```

What version of Node.js is required to build? I tried Node 18 and 20

Please add a `CONTRIBUTING` file or build instructions to the `README` since this project does not build "out of the box".
